Creston Moly Acquires Tenajon Resources

Creston Moly (TSXV:CMS) annouced today that the company has entered into a Letter Agreement to merge with Tenajon Resources (TSXV:TJS). Creston Moly will acquire the shares of Tenajon by issuing 0.84 Creston shares for each Tenajon share. Stimulus spending could bridge the gap in molybdenum prices

Moly Investing News reports molybdenum prices may have an upswing effect with the stimulus spending package. The market price of molybdenum oxide in the 2008 fell steeply from US $34 per pound to US$ 8.75 per pound at the end December.
